1. A head-mounted display device comprising:

  • an image sensor configured to capture an image of a portion of an environment viewable through the head-mounted display device;

    a display configured to display an image captured by the image sensor of the portion of the environment viewable through the head-mounted display device, the display comprising at least one diffraction grating member comprising a plurality of laminated diffraction grating layers each causing diffractive reflection of light beams of a different wavelength band;

    a light shutter configured to, while the captured image is displayed, block ambient light from the environment from passing through any portion of the light shutter when the head-mounted display device is configured in a first mode of operation and further configured to allow a portion of ambient light from the environment to pass through the light shutter when the head-mounted display is configured in a second mode of operation;

    a control circuit configured to selectively place the head-mounted display in either of the first mode of operation or the second mode of operation; and

    at least one storage device configured to store display data corresponding to stored information that identifies feature points of various objects;

    wherein the control circuit is further configured to process the image captured by the image sensor to extract feature points therefrom and to compare the extracted feature points with the information stored in the at least one storage device to determine whether the extracted feature points conform to the feature points identified by the stored information;

    wherein the display is further configured to, for at least one of the first or second modes of operation of the head-mounted display device, display the display data together with the captured image when the control circuit determines that the extracted feature points conform to the feature points identified by the stored information.
